#2c2b60 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2c2b60 is composed of 17.3% red, 16.9%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.2% cyan, 55.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 62.4% black. It has a hue angle of 241.1 degrees, a saturation of 38.1% and a lightness of 27.3%. #2c2b60 color hex could be obtained by blending #5856c0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

#2c2b60 color description : Very dark desaturated blue.

#2c2b60 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#2c2b60 has RGB values of R:44, G:43, B:96 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0.55, Y:0,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 2894688.

Shades and Tints of #2c2b60

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f3f3f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2c2b60

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#41404b is the less saturated color, while #03008b is the most saturated one.
